Ryan Egan - lyrics

Top Ryan Egan albums

Postures

(2016)

Top Ryan Egan lyrics

Watercolor
Ryan Egan

277

Restoration
Ryan Egan

287

344

Finest Hour
Ryan Egan

308

Cocoon
Ryan Egan

288

404

Ryan Egan biography